Healthy guts
THE human gut consists of a complex
community of microorganisms known as gut
microbiota. A child’s gut microbiota is more
susceptible compared with an adult’s, as

for stronger kids


children are born with sterile intestinal
tracts and gut microbiota only begin
developing after birth through interactions
with the environment.
This early establishment of gut microbiota
may be easily disrupted by factors such as
caesarean delivery, formula feeding and use
of antibiotics. A disrupted gut microbiota
balance in children may result in weakened
immunity, cases of diarrhoea, constipation
or upset stomach.
